What are three examples of internet marketing strategies?

Internet Marketing is a term that encompasses online activities intended to promote products, services, and other related topics. Internet marketing covers email marketing as well social media marketing, search engine optimiz (SEO), PPC advertising (PPC), web design and other related activities.

This does not mean you need to spend money to make it happen. There are many methods to generate income, and you don't have to spend any cash. The return on each investment will be greater if you make more.

The most common form of internet marketing is email marketing. This involves sending email to potential customers with information about your business, and its latest offers.

Another popular way to market is via social media. Users can interact with family and friends on social media sites such LinkedIn, Twitter and Facebook. Businesses also have the opportunity to reach out to their customers and raise awareness about their products and services through these sites.

Search Engine Optimization (SEO), is a technique that improves the visibility of websites in major search engines. Webmasters have the ability to increase traffic to their sites by improving the quality or quantity of relevant backlinks.

Website design refers to the art of creating websites that look good and function well. Website designers design the website's layout. Website designers also ensure that the website meets accessibility standards and complies with technical specifications.

Advertising called Pay Per Click (PPC) allows advertisers to bid on keywords relevant their products and/or services. Advertisers are paid for each click on their ads. PPC ads often appear at either the top or lowest search results pages.

Deciphering GA4: Unveiling the Basics

Understanding the Evolution

GA4 isn't just another iteration of Google Analytics; it represents a complete transformation of the platform. Shifting from a session-based model, GA4 adopts an event-centric approach, focusing on user interactions like page views, button clicks, and engagement. It's like diving into each visitor's story, not just the pages they visit.

Challenges Faced in the GA4 Landscape

Navigating the New Interface

One of the key hurdles with GA4 is its complex interface, especially for those accustomed to older Google Analytics versions. It requires learning new features and reorienting to locate familiar data.

Ensuring Data Tracking Compliance

GA4 prioritizes data privacy regulations, which is a positive step. However, this shift also brings tracking constraints and a loss of detailed data that marketers have come to rely on.

Migrating Historical Data

Transitioning to GA4 doesn't allow for full historical data import from Universal Analytics. This limitation can be particularly challenging for businesses heavily reliant on historical data for analysis and decision-making.

Mastering the Learning Curve

GA4 isn't just an update; it's a whole new ball game. Marketers need to grasp new functionalities and adopt a fresh mindset for interpreting data. This poses a significant challenge for teams accustomed to traditional methods.

Six Types Of Ecommerce Marketing

How do I market an eCommerce store?

Ecommerce marketing is one of the most challenging marketing tasks. This requires you to get to know your customers, their buying habits, and how they interact and use your products and services. This knowledge can help you create a strategy to achieve your goals.

There are six types of eCommerce marketing strategies:

  1. Product Strategy – The first step to deciding what product you want online is to determine your product type. There are three main categories: physical goods (things), digital goods (services), and membership sites. After you've chosen which category of goods you want to work with you will need decide whether you offer wholesale or regular retail prices. Wholesale pricing means you set the price you sell your products, while retail pricing means you charge customers directly for your products.
  2. Pricing Strategy: Next, decide how much you want to earn from selling products. Profit margins and competition are important. Shipping costs, taxes, and other fees should also be considered. You can increase your profits by lowering your cost per sale or increasing your sales volume when you are deciding on your pricing strategy.
  3. Promotion Strategy – This is where the fun begins! It is important to create a promotion strategy that will work best for your company. There are many options, such as free shipping, special discount, deals, coupons, or other incentives. You might try to think of new promotional ideas, if none are available.
  4. Shipping Strategy – After you have determined how to promote your products you must now think about how you will get them in front of people. Do you ship via USPS, FedEx, UPS, DHL, or another delivery service? Are you going to use a fulfillment center or will you do it all yourself?
  5. Merchandise Management System – Your merchandise management system includes software that helps you manage inventory, track orders, fulfill orders, and communicate with suppliers. You can choose from many different systems depending on your budget and preferences.
  6. Customer Service Strategy – You need to design a customer support strategy that will work for you business. Will you provide telephone support or email support? Are customers able to contact you via chat, email, social media, and even postal mail?
